The author studies global solutions containing a single transonic shock wave for the general quasilinear hyperbolic system \(U+F=G\) which is considered in one-dimensional space. The presence of \(G\) brings about secondary waves. The author singles out the amount of such waves along each characteristic field and shows that global-in-time solutions exist provided the total variation of \(U\), \(|G|\), and the total amount of secondary waves along the transonic characteristic are sufficiently small.
